    Description by oid_info

    atmClpTransparentScr OBJECT-IDENTITY
    STATUS current
    DESCRIPTION
    "This traffic descriptor type is for the CLP-
    transparent model with Sustained Cell Rate.
    The use of the parameter vector for this type:
    Parameter 1: peak cell rate in cells/second
    for CLP=0+1 traffic
    Parameter 2: sustainable cell rate in cells/second
    for CLP=0+1 traffic
    Parameter 3: maximum burst size in cells
    Parameter 4: CDVT in tenths of microseconds
    Parameter 5: not used.
    This traffic descriptor type is applicable to
    connections following the VBR.1 conformance
    definition.
    Connections specifying this traffic descriptor
    type will be rejected at UNI 3.0 or UNI 3.1
    interfaces. For a similar traffic descriptor
    type that can be accepted at UNI 3.0 and
    UNI 3.1 interfaces, see atmNoClpScr."
    REFERENCE
    "ATM Forum,ATM User-Network Interface,
    Version 3.0 (UNI 3.0) Specification, 1994.
    ATM Forum, ATM User-Network Interface,
    Version 3.1 (UNI 3.1) Specification,
    November 1994.
    ATM Forum, Traffic Management Specification,
    Version 4.0, af-tm-0056.000, June 1996."
